Job Description

Your role at Micron Technology involves assuming management responsibility for Disaster Recovery planning efforts, with a focus on ensuring the adequacy of contingency plans for critical business areas, functions, and applications. You will work closely with business unit management to enhance disaster recovery plans, aiming to mitigate the impact of technology system or application failures. Your key objectives include enabling business units to manage assets effectively, meet regulatory obligations, and uphold their presence in the marketplace. As part of your responsibilities, you will provide direct communication between the BCP/Crisis Management Team, IT DR Stakeholders, Incident Response Teams, ITLT & Business Users. Additionally, you will participate in business unit and development planning meetings, facilitating the timely identification, escalation, resolution, and follow-up of outstanding issues. You will play a leadership role in developing comprehensive contingency plans and validation methodologies to ensure Micron's ability to recover in the event of disruptions. Your role will also involve performing various job duties such as metrics gathering, planning, testing, documentation, and providing Disaster Recovery Planning documentation and training to employees. You will conduct periodic reviews and tests of established Disaster Recovery plans, reporting findings to management and making recommendations for improvements as necessary. To excel in this role, you should have 2-5 years of experience and a background in team environments related to Business Impact Analysis projects and ITDR program work. You should possess a sound knowledge of Information and operational technologies, information security practices, and have experience in conducting risk assessments and impact analysis work. Additionally, you should understand the relationship between business impact analysis, risk assessments, and IT disaster recovery plan development. Preferred skills for this role include a combination of IT disaster recovery and business continuity concepts knowledge. Experience in planning, leading, organizing, and controlling IT system-related projects for the enterprise is also desirable.
